Microsoft Office Process Setting Persistence via Startup


Description

Identifies files written to or modified in the startup folder by a Microsoft Office process. Adversaries may use this technique to maintain persistence and avoid spawning suspicious child processes.

Query · eql

file where event.action != "deletion" and
  file.path : ("?:\\Users\\*\\AppData\\Roaming\\Microsoft\\Windows\\Start Menu\\Programs\\Startup\\*",
               "?:\\ProgramData\\Microsoft\\Windows\\Start Menu\\Programs\\StartUp\\*") and
  process.name : ("EQNEDT32.EXE", "WINWORD.EXE", "EXCEL.EXE", "POWERPNT.EXE", "MSPUB.EXE") and
  not file.extension : ("docx", "xls", "doc", "xlsx", "tmp", "xlsm") and file.name : "*.*"
